Canadian professional baseball player Joey Votto with an estimated net worth of $50.4 million.

Joey Votto started off his career when he was drafted by the Cincinnati Reds in 2002. He played for its affiliate, Class A Dayton Dragons with 26 doubles, 14 home runs which resulted to his promotion to the Class A Advanced Potomac. Before hitting the Majors, he was hailed as the Southern League's Most Valuable Player.

In 2007, he debuted with the Major League during the match against New York Mets. Votto received the National League MVP award, National League Hank Aaron award, and Lou Marsh Trophy in 2010.

Votto extended his stay with the Reds and signed a 10-year team contract. He was named as the Face of the MLB which was voted by fans through the microblogging site Twitter in 2013.

Joseph Daniel Votto was born on September 10, 1983 in Toronto, Ontario, Canada.
